Job Description and Duties


Under the supervision of a Deputy Labor Commissioner III (Senior Deputy) or designee, conducts intake investigations for settlement conferences or inspections. Coordinates intake workshops or clinics to ensure claims filed by workers are complete. Performs referrals to other units, educates the public on labor laws, and applies theories to assess violations on liable employers in wage claim processing. Also involves enforcement of wage and hour laws in the WCA program.
